PostgreSql

PostgreSql과 MySql 차이점

pjh8838 2024. 12. 9. 13:25
반응형

1. 데이터 타입

  • PostgreSQL은 JSONB, UUID, ARRAY 같은 다양한 데이터 타입을 지원한다. MySQL은 JSON 타입만 지원하고 JSONB는 없다.
  • 예시:

2. 문자열 함수와 연산자

  • PostgreSQL에서는 문자열을 결합할 때 || 연산자를 사용하고, MySQL은 CONCAT() 함수를 사용한다.
  • 예시:
    •  

3. 자동 증가값 (Auto-increment)

4. 조인 (Join) 처리

  • PostgreSQLMySQL은 조인 구문이 비슷하지만, PostgreSQL은 성능 최적화에 더 유리한 방법을 제공한다.
  • 예시:

5. 특정 기능 차이점

  • JSON 처리: PostgreSQL은 JSONB로 더 빠르고 강력하게 JSON을 처리한다. MySQL은 JSON만 지원한다.

6. 쿼리 성능과 최적화

  • PostgreSQL은 복잡한 쿼리와 대용량 데이터 처리에 유리하다. MySQL은 읽기 속도가 빠르고 간단한 쿼리에서 빠를 수 있다.
  • 예시:

728x90
반응형